Burnout is a state of mental exhaustion brought on by problems at work/home.
Burnout most often occurs when a person is not in control of how a job is carried out, at work or home, or is asked to complete tasks that conflict with their sense of self.
Burnt-out employees have very low motivation to perform at their best and may have a higher rate of absenteeism. Their work is more prone to errors and therefore managers can notice a steep declines in their productivity and quality of work.
